Abstract

This paper proposes an ongoing work on a novel Internet of Things (IoT) text-messaging system that leverages LoRa communications to interconnect end-users. The system aims to provide efficient and reliable communication between IoT devices by establishing a robust backbone network capable of combating packet flooding. With LoRa, the system achieves extended coverage, allowing devices in remote areas to stay connected while permanent network infrastructures are absent. Moreover, the system emphasizes the importance of user-friendly text messaging, providing a familiar and intuitive means of communication for end-users. By integrating the simplicity of text messaging combined with the long-range capabilities of LoRa, the system enables seamless and efficient communication across various IoT devices, enhancing user experience and promoting widespread adoption. Through extensive testing and evaluation, the system demonstrates its effectiveness in establishing a reliable and scalable IoT text-messaging infrastructure with a very low overhead.
